The GOAT’s Grand Indian Sojourn: Itinerary of an Icon

Lionel Messi’s three-day whirlwind tour of India is a testament to his global stardom and the country’s burgeoning status as a hotspot for international icons. Fresh from clinching the Major League Soccer (MLS) title with Inter Miami, Messi’s itinerary is a packed schedule of glamour, charity, and fan engagement. The tour will see him touch down in multiple cities, including Kolkata, Hyderabad, and Delhi, before the crown jewel event in Mumbai.

The focus, however, remains firmly on the financial capital on December 14th. Here, at a high-profile charity event, Messi will accomplish a first in his storied career: a ramp walk in a Mumbai fashion show. He won’t be alone on the catwalk. In a delightful twist for football fans, his longtime friend and former Barcelona teammate Luis Suarez, and current Argentine compatriot Rodrigo de Paul, are also confirmed to strut their stuff. This trio transforms the event from a mere fashion show into a rare congregation of footballing greatness.

Decoding the Event: Philanthropy Meets Unprecedented Access

Promoter Satadru Dutta has framed the night as a “fully reserved” affair, an exclusive gathering of India’s elite. The guest list is a who’s who of Bollywood, business, and sports, with names like Tiger Shroff, Jackie Shroff, and John Abraham expected to grace the occasion. But beneath the veneer of celebrity lies the event’s core mission: philanthropy.

The centerpiece of the charity drive is an auction that promises to make headlines worldwide. Messi will put one of his personal FIFA World Cup 2022 memorabilia items under the hammer. The specifics of the item—whether it’s his match-worn jersey from the epic final, his golden boot, or another artifact from Qatar—remain a closely guarded secret, amplifying the anticipation. This isn’t just an auction; it’s a chance to own a tangible piece of the narrative that cemented Messi’s status as the Greatest Of All Time.
